    Business Insight Malaya | REY O. ARCILLA

    Former Chief Justice Hilario Davide, Jr. recently resigned as Philippine permanent representative to the UN and joined the Aquino bandwagon so he could "campaign for change."

    Yeah, right!

    Davide was in the UN post in New York for more than three years.

    He went there without confirmation from the Commission on Appointments which was in violation of the Constitution.


    For three years, he was representing and defending the Arroyo regime before the international community. And then, three months before he was to give up the post anyway, he suddenly resigns to campaign for Aquino "because the people can never forget and can never tolerate graft and corruption." Kuno.

    Such hypocrisy! I wonder what Arroyo must think of him now.

    Does he mean he was not aware at all of the graft and corruption in the Arroyo regime during the last three years he was defending it? He was not aware of the odious ZTE-NBN deal, the fertilizer scam, the lavish dinners at the Le Cirque restaurant in New York, etc., etc., ad nauseam?

    Geez, was he in a different planet?

    He resigned at a most convenient time (for him) mainly because he wanted to campaign for his son who is running for governor of Cebu – under the LP banner!

    Davide was also quoted as saying he is campaigning hard (for the LP) "knowing that a victory will be sure for Noynoy and Mar and the entire LP." Now, isn’t that a dead giveaway as to his real motive?


    Suddenly, he is rumored to be a candidate for Foreign Secretary in an Aquino administration.

    And then there is mention of Arroyo’s itinerant future ex-Foreign Secretary, Alberto Romulo, joining the Aquino camp, something he had in fact already indicated months ago when he proclaimed publicly that he will support Aquino. Romulo is rumored to have asked for the ambassadorial post in Spain in exchange for that support.
